Synopsis for "Live, Kree or Die, Part II: Stuck in the Middle"
Two people rob an electronics store, but are stopped by Captain America. He then talks to Councilman Bolt and promises to try and help his campaign after the Skrull fiasco. Captain America is then called down to Cape Canaveral by Warbird, who has requested the help of him and the other Avengers to fight off some Kree invaders calling themselves the Lunatic Legion. After calling Cap, Warbird gets captured by the Kree, who try to experiment on her to use her genes to enhance their race.
In Los Angeles, General Chapman publicly reveals the details of a plan to kill the King of Moldavia, and does not seem to care if his soldiers are killed.
Cap arrives at Cape Canaveral and frees Warbird, who is being held with a whole bunch of other prisoners. As Cap and Warbird work to free them, Warbird reveals that she didn't call the other Avengers, as she is trying to prove to Cap that she belongs on the Avengers despite her waning powers. Cap tells her that he doesn't care that her powers are weaker than they used to be, but she is threatening her status as an Avenger by acting recklessly. The Kree then begin to launch their rocket to return to their base on the Moon, and Cap wants to save the prisoners from the rocket's liftoff while Warbird wants to chase the Kree. Cap tells her that the people come first, but Warbird flies off to prove herself, telling Cap that he can save the prisoners while she avenges them. Warbird is immediately captured again, leaving Cap to vow to save her.
Notes
Continuity Notes[]
- This issue is Part II of Live Kree or Die storyline, which began in Iron Man (Vol. 3) #7 (Part I), and continues in Quicksilver #10 (Part III) and concludes in Avengers (Vol. 3) #7 (Part IV).
